A young Ukrainian was tortured and burned to death in Vienna over cryptocurrency

A young Ukrainian was tortured and burned to death in Vienna over cryptocurrency

A tragedy shocked the public in Vienna: 21-year-old Ukrainian student Danilo Kuzmin, the son of the deputy mayor of Kharkiv, became the victim of a brutal crime. According to Austrian police, unknown assailants tortured the young man to force him to transfer funds from his cryptocurrency wallet and then burned him to death in his own car.

The murder took place in the Donaustadt district. A black Mercedes parked on Marlen-Haushoffer-Weg caught fire overnight. Witnesses who noticed the fire called the police, who found the charred body of a man inside the car with obvious signs of brutal beatings.

Police determined that Kuzmin was attacked in the underground garage of an upscale hotel located near the center of Vienna. The student was held in the car for approximately four hours until he transferred his digital assets to wallets controlled by the attackers.

Cryptocurrency Theft



Vienna Police Chief of Criminal Investigation Gerhard Winkler reported that a large sum of cryptocurrency was withdrawn from Kuzmin's wallet. The exact amount of stolen assets was not specified, but preliminary reports indicate the dollar equivalent could be significant. Identification of the Criminals



Police were able to identify the attackers through CCTV footage and track their escape routes. One of the perpetrators studied at the same university as Kuzmin, suggesting a possible acquaintance with the victim. Two Ukrainian citizens, aged 19 and 45, have been named as suspects.

After committing the crime, they returned to Ukraine, where they were detained on the basis of an international warrant issued by Austrian police. Cash, presumably obtained from the sale of cryptocurrency, was seized from the detainees. The suspects are expected to be extradited to Austria in the coming days.
